> Now at first some generally questions (I don't  found an answer for this
> in the docu):
> Is it possible to create a PV on a extended partion or do I need only
> primary partions ?

You can use primary _and_ extended partitions.

> I think pvcreate writes something at the top of the physical volume (
> whole PV or partion).
> Do that works well with other OS-formated parts of the same hdisk ?
> 

Yes, it does.

If you use a partition with pvcreate, you have to set the partition identifier
to 0xfe with fdisk before.
pvcreate checks for this partition identifier to avoid to overwrite _non_
LVM partitions by accident 8*)
